        Gearing is fine. Whether you need a spacer or not and whether it will fit under the cover is entirely dependent on the tyre. My 275/65 17 Scorpians needed the spacer (thanks again amts) and it would fit the cover but the cover is in the shed. I hate the things, rubbish gets caught behind them and this scratches the paint and it is exceptional fun to fit the cover over a flat tyre that has sat for a while let alone a shredded tyre.

              You may not want or need it, bt I would double check that the BFG A/T are "LT" or Light Truck Construction.

              Also, the current BFG A/T tyres are now in run out, as they have introduced a new tyre....but honestly, I would grab the BFG A/T current production again....as I have found them o be superb, at over 100,000km now, they have lasted well..across the desert, across the top, across the beaches, fantastic, but I rotate all the tyres, including the spare, wheel balance and align every 20,000 km, and I also run the at 42psi (unloaded) on the highway, about 34psi on gravel, about 22psi on sand, and down to about 18psi or there about on soft sand (but no hard cornering with low tyre pressures)....
